| 16 | struct _PerlIO_funcs { |
| 17 | Size_t fsize; |
| 18 | const char *name; |
| 19 | Size_t size; |
| 20 | U32 kind; |
| 21 | IV (*Pushed) (pTHX_ PerlIO *f, const char *mode, SV *arg, PerlIO_funcs *tab); |
| 22 | IV (*Popped) (pTHX_ PerlIO *f); |
| 23 | PerlIO *(*Open) (pTHX_ PerlIO_funcs *tab, |
| 24 | PerlIO_list_t *layers, IV n, |
| 25 | const char *mode, |
| 26 | int fd, int imode, int perm, |
| 27 | PerlIO *old, int narg, SV **args); |
| 28 | IV (*Binmode)(pTHX_ PerlIO *f); |
| 29 | SV *(*Getarg) (pTHX_ PerlIO *f, CLONE_PARAMS *param, int flags); |
| 30 | IV (*Fileno) (pTHX_ PerlIO *f); |
| 31 | PerlIO *(*Dup) (pTHX_ PerlIO *f, PerlIO *o, CLONE_PARAMS *param, int flags); |
| 32 | /* Unix-like functions - cf sfio line disciplines */ |
| 33 | SSize_t(*Read) (pTHX_ PerlIO *f, void *vbuf, Size_t count); |
| 34 | SSize_t(*Unread) (pTHX_ PerlIO *f, const void *vbuf, Size_t count); |
| 35 | SSize_t(*Write) (pTHX_ PerlIO *f, const void *vbuf, Size_t count); |
| 36 | IV (*Seek) (pTHX_ PerlIO *f, Off_t offset, int whence); |
| 37 | Off_t(*Tell) (pTHX_ PerlIO *f); |
| 38 | IV (*Close) (pTHX_ PerlIO *f); |
| 39 | /* Stdio-like buffered IO functions */ |
| 40 | IV (*Flush) (pTHX_ PerlIO *f); |
| 41 | IV (*Fill) (pTHX_ PerlIO *f); |
| 42 | IV (*Eof) (pTHX_ PerlIO *f); |
| 43 | IV (*Error) (pTHX_ PerlIO *f); |
| 44 | void (*Clearerr) (pTHX_ PerlIO *f); |
| 45 | void (*Setlinebuf) (pTHX_ PerlIO *f); |
| 46 | /* Perl's snooping functions */ |
| 47 | STDCHAR *(*Get_base) (pTHX_ PerlIO *f); |
| 48 | Size_t(*Get_bufsiz) (pTHX_ PerlIO *f); |
| 49 | STDCHAR *(*Get_ptr) (pTHX_ PerlIO *f); |
| 50 | SSize_t(*Get_cnt) (pTHX_ PerlIO *f); |
| 51 | void (*Set_ptrcnt) (pTHX_ PerlIO *f, STDCHAR * ptr, SSize_t cnt); |
| 52 | }; |

| 130 | /*--------------------------------------------------------------------------------------*/ |
| 131 | /* perlio buffer layer |
| 132 | As this is reasonably generic its struct and "methods" are declared here |
| 133 | so they can be used to "inherit" from it. |
| 134 | */ |
| 135 | |
| 136 | typedef struct { |
| 137 | struct _PerlIO base; /* Base "class" info */ |
| 138 | STDCHAR *buf; /* Start of buffer */ |
| 139 | STDCHAR *end; /* End of valid part of buffer */ |
| 140 | STDCHAR *ptr; /* Current position in buffer */ |
| 141 | Off_t posn; /* Offset of buf into the file */ |
| 142 | Size_t bufsiz; /* Real size of buffer */ |
| 143 | IV oneword; /* Emergency buffer */ |
| 144 | } PerlIOBuf; |
